Managing continuous audits in software systems can feel overwhelming without a structured approach. Continuous audit readiness ensures that systems are always prepared for scrutiny, with the right data, processes, and tools in place to pass audits smoothly. This guide covers the essentials for implementing and maintaining continuous audit readiness.
What Is Continuous Audit Readiness?
Continuous audit readiness means your systems and processes are always in a state where they can be audited without extensive preparation. This involves having automated, traceable workflows, centralized data, and clear compliance pipelines. By embedding systems that support auditability, teams reduce the stress of last-minute audit preparations and stay one step ahead.
The goal is simple: spend less time firefighting and more time maintaining compliance while supporting operational efficiency.
Why Does It Matter?
Meeting audit requirements isn’t optional. Failing to comply with industry, security, or regulatory standards can result in penalties, security breaches, or reputational damage. Continuous audit readiness allows organizations to:
- Identify Issues Early: Pinpoint problems before auditors do.
- Reduce Risks: Regular monitoring lowers the chances of violations.
- Save Time: Eliminate last-minute chaos by automating compliance checks.
- Build Trust: Assure stakeholders that your systems are reliable and compliant.
Key Pillars of Continuous Audit Readiness
1. Centralized Monitoring and Logging
Audits rely on accurate, complete, and easily accessible data. Centralized logging ensures all critical events, configurations, and system changes are tracked in one place. This makes it easier to provide evidence of compliance without manually pulling logs from disparate sources.
What to Do:
- Set up centralized logging tools that integrate across your stack.
- Automatically tag and timestamp logs for traceability.
- Regularly verify log integrity with checksums or tamper-proof mechanisms.
2. Automated Compliance Checks
Relying on manual audits is not scalable or reliable. Automation in compliance checks reduces human error and ensures consistency. Define policies tied to your compliance goals and automate their enforcement and validation.
What to Do:
- Use automation to enforce coding and pipeline quality gates.
- Scan for technical debt, misconfigurations, and permissions at every stage.
- Automate security testing, such as dependency scanning and vulnerability checks.
3. Continuous Documentation Updates
Outdated documentation causes delays during audits. Engineers manually chasing updates wastes time and can lead to gaps. Keeping documentation updated in real time ensures you have the right reports when auditors come knocking.
What to Do:
- Pair documentation updates with development workflows.
- Link documentation to code repositories and pipelines.
- Retire stale documentation regularly to focus on relevant materials.
4. Audit Trails by Design
Systems must have built-in features that enable teams to trace every action. Audit trails should be verifiable, unalterable, and directly connected to the systems they’re monitoring.
What to Do:
- Embed audit trails into pipelines and workflows.
- Restrict trail manipulations to authorized users only.
- Log key events such as deployments, API calls, and configuration changes.
5. Regular Readiness Reviews
Continuous audit readiness requires ongoing review. Regular self-audits and performance checks help teams stay aligned with evolving compliance requirements and address risks before they escalate.
What to Do:
- Schedule periodic reviews of your systems against audit standards.
- Test your readiness with mock audits to ensure gaps are identified early.
- Monitor how well automation rules align with shifting compliance needs.
Simplifying Continuous Audit Readiness with Technology
Traditional approaches often require tedious manual effort to maintain compliance. Integrated developer tools significantly reduce redundant effort while promoting transparency. With the right platform, you can automate monitoring, stay compliant, and receive detailed audit logs tailored to your needs—all without losing development velocity.
Get Started with Hoop.dev
Auditing doesn’t have to slow you down. With Hoop.dev, you can set up automated policies, track critical workflows, and generate audit trails—all working seamlessly behind the scenes in minutes. Whether you need to integrate pipelines or ensure complete compliance, everything you need is at your fingertips.
Enable streamlined audit readiness today with Hoop.dev and see it live in action—get started now!